The attack and destruction of cars and Tesla dealers also occurred in Europe. This action is believed to be in line with the rejection of Elon Musk who is now close to the Donal Trump government.
Quoted from the Guardian, on Saturday last weekend, there were seven Tesla cars burned in a dealer located in Ottersberg, Germany. Similar events propagated to Sweden.
Two Tesla dealers reported at Stockholm and Malmo were damaged by unknown people on Monday (3/31) local time. Destruction is done by spraying orange paint.

The latest happened in Italy. Although not yet known exactly what caused it, there were 17 Tesla cars on fire on a dealer in the city of Rome.
Although the investigation is still carried out, the Italian anti -terror police deployed to help deal with this case. The Minister of the Interior Italian has even sent a letter to the police to increase security in Tesla dealers in Italy, as a step to anticipate the existence of aftershocks.
In some videos posted on social media X, a large fire was seen produced from the Tesla car fire. Through his official account, Musk called what happened in Rome as ‘terrorism’.

Since Trump was appointed as the President of the American Srikat in January 2025, Musk immediately became a person in the close circle of Trump. Musk was also given a strategic position in the ‘Department of Government Efficiency’.
This then triggered a wave of protest and boykot against Tesla cars. More than that, some destruction also occurred in the United States, which then spread to Europe.
Protests against Musk and Tesla are actually more peaceful. But in some cases the destruction emerged, both in the Tesla car and in the electric vehicle dealers.
